在智能手机的江湖中,安卓系统无疑是一个响当当的名字。它不仅以其开放性赢得了全球数亿用户的青睐,更因其开源的特性,成为了技术创新和产业发展的推动力。那么,安卓系统究竟是不是一个开源系统?它开源的背后又有哪些魔力与挑战呢?本文将为您一一揭晓。
首先,我们来明确一下“开源”这个概念。开源,全称为开放源代码,指的是软件的源代码可以被公众访问、查看、修改和分发。这种模式与闭源软件相对,后者则将源代码保密,只有软件开发者才有权限访问和修改。
安卓系统是由谷歌公司开发的,它基于Linux内核,是一个典型的开源操作系统。安卓的开源之路始于2007年,当时谷歌宣布将安卓开源,并成立了一个名为“安卓开源项目”(AOSP)的组织,旨在维护和推动安卓系统的开源发展。
安卓系统的开源特性,为其带来了巨大的魔力。首先,开源使得全球的开发者可以自由地参与到安卓系统的开发中,这极大地促进了技术的创新。其次,开源使得安卓系统可以快速迭代,满足不同用户的需求。开源也促进了软件生态的繁荣,无数的应用和游戏开发者基于安卓平台,为用户提供了丰富的选择。
开源也带来了一些挑战。首先,开源项目往往涉及众多开发者,如何进行有效的管理和决策,是一个难题。其次,开源系统的安全性也备受关注,由于源代码的公开,恶意攻击者更容易找到系统的漏洞。此外,开源项目还可能面临知识产权的争议。
面对开源带来的挑战,安卓系统在未来的发展中,可能会寻求开源与闭源的平衡。一方面,保持开源的特性,继续吸引全球开发者参与,推动技术创新;另一方面,加强系统的安全性管理,确保用户的安全和隐私。
安卓系统的开源特性,使其在智能手机市场中占据了重要地位。虽然开源带来了一些挑战,但不可否认的是,开源为安卓系统带来了创新、共享和繁荣。在未来的发展中,安卓系统将继续在开源的道路上探索,为用户带来更好的体验。